**All members please note what a Constructive Review is.**
A review should be clear, concise and honest.
A review should contain what you like and/or what you don't like about a particular story.
A review should at all times be polite, friendly and peaceful.
A review can focus on any of the following things:-
- Plot.
- Characters.
- Spelling, Punctuation and Grammar.
- Canon.
- Plot Errors.
- Coherancy.
- General Presentation.
Remember that where there is something you dislike. State what it is, why you dislike it, and what could make it better.
That is what an aspiring author wants to hear.
They want to know how they can make things better.
